Norman Mauney

February 28, 1938 — September 21, 2013

SHELBY-Mr. Norman Mauney, 75, of Foust Rd., died Sat., Sept. 21, 2013 at Hospice at Wendover. A native of Cleveland County, he was the son of the late Webb and Bessie Codgell Mauney. He retired from textiles and was a member of Buffalo Baptist Church. He loved camping and fishing.

PRECEDED: In addition to his parents, he was preceded in death by his wife, Sarah Crowder Mauney; step-son, Russell Crowder; and brothers, James and C.W. Mauney.

SURVIVED: He is survived by his son, Dusty Mauney of Cherryville; three sisters, Vernie Wall of Lattimore, Betty Nelson, and Rachel Mauney, both of Shelby; three brothers, Forrest Mauney of Boiling Springs, Ralph Mauney and wife Debbie, and Billy Ray Mauney, all of Shelby.
